Schedule of Application
The latest application period for the Electronic Technicians Licensure Examination ECTLE) was from July 25, 2025 to September 22, 2025.
- ECTLE Opening of Application: July 25, 2025
- ECTLE Deadline of Application: September 22, 2025
Following with the Important schedule which are the next batch Exam Date and Target release of result:
- ECTLE Examination Date: October 20, 2025
- ECTLE Target Release of Result: October 24, 2025

Requirement for Filing the Application
Above are the following Requirements you need.
- NSO / PSA Birth Certificate
- NSO / PSA Marriage Contract (for married female applicants)
- Transcript of Records with scanned picture and Remarks “For Board Examination Purposes”
- Payment: P600.00
- Graduate of a minimum two year Associate, Technician, Trade of Vocational course in Electronics or has completed at least 3rd year BS ECE – First Timers – FTB
- Graduates of BS Computer Engineering must taken the subject of “ECE LAWS & ETHICS”

How to Apply for the Electronic Technicians Board Exam
So, you’re planning to take the Electronic Technicians Board Exam in 2025? Great! Here’s a simple and easy-to-follow guide to help you apply step by step.
Step 1: Make Sure You’re Qualified to Apply
Before anything else, let’s see if you’re eligible:
- ✅ You’re a Filipino citizen
- ✅ You have a degree in BS in Electronics Technology (or an equivalent course)
- ✅ You have all the required documents (see Step 2 below)
- ✅ The PRC application schedule for the exam is open (check the application schedule above!)
If you answered YES to all, then you’re ready to apply!
Step 2: Prepare These Documents and Requirements
Make sure you gather digital copies (for upload) and printed copies (for submission at the PRC office). Here’s what you need:
For All Applicants:
- PSA Birth Certificate
- Transcript of Records (TOR) with scanned photo and the remark: “For Board Examination Purposes”
- PSA Marriage Certificate (only for married female applicants)
- Valid NBI Clearance (for first-time takers and repeaters)
- Application Fee: ₱900 (plus a ₱20 fee if paying online via GCash, Maya, or other platforms)
📌Tips: Make sure all your documents are clear and valid. Double-check names, dates, and spellings — they must match your PRC profile exactly.
Step 3: Create or Log In to Your PRC LERIS Account
Now that you have your documents ready, it’s time to go online:
- Go to https://online.prc.gov.ph
- If you’re new, click “Register” and create an account
- If you already have one, just log in
📌Reminder: Your profile details (name, date of birth, etc.) should match your documents.
Step 4: File Your Application Online
Once you’re logged in:
- Click “Examination”
- Select “Electronics Technician” as your exam type
- Choose your preferred exam date and PRC testing center
- Upload your scanned documents (must be clear and complete)
- Schedule your appointment with the nearest PRC office
- Pay the application fee (₱600) via:
- GCash
- Maya
- LandBank
- Over-the-counter (PRC-accredited payment centers)
📌Reminder: After payment, download and print your Application Form from the portal — you’ll need it on your appointment day.
Step 5: Go to the PRC Office for Final Verification
On your scheduled appointment day, bring these:
- Printed Application Form
- Original and photocopies of all your documents
- A valid government-issued ID
- ₱21 for the documentary stamp
- ₱30 for the metered mailing envelope
The PRC staff will check your documents and process your application. If everything is complete, you’ll receive:
- ✅ Notice of Admission (NOA)
- ✅ Program of Examination
- ✅ Mailing envelope
